This page defines the approval path for changes to the Trailmark audit-log viewer. Because the viewer exposes sensitive administrative actions, every change — including copy tweaks and filter adjustments — requires a documented review. Pull requests must link to a threat-model note, pass the redaction test suite, and receive one reviewer approval before the final gate. Emergency patches follow the same path with a retroactive review within two business days. The final approval gate is held by the person named below.

account owner for fajep-yagef: Kasix Eliiel

**Ticket OPS-913: Drift in rotor-cli settings across environments**

Our secrets-rotation utility, Rotor, has drifted: dev rotates every 30 days, prod every 90, and the Kestrel cluster apparently never. Nobody can say which is intended. Manual edits bypassed the config repo for months. Action: declare one canonical config, enforce via CI, and delete local overrides. Until then, treat prod as source of truth. The current prod values are captured below.

config for kafof-bawef:
holath:
  log_level: debug
  metrics_host: metrics.holath.qorvelsys.internal
  pin: 2191
  pool_size: 32

- [ ] Before rotating the Pondleaf signing key, drain the connection pool on the Marlow cluster. Yes, all of it — stale pooled connections will cling to the old cert and you'll chase ghost errors for an hour. Once pool metrics hit zero, seal the old key and note the passphrase below.

recovery phrase for yahag-yagap: pramir-normir-norius-kasax